The development of the platform for providing the fans with control over the teams’ decisions on the field of play and outside of it started in 2015. In February 2017 the first spot team controlled by the fans - Salt Lake Screaming Eagles – debuted in a small League. The experiment led to the results faerie in any regard. Okay! What did the project and the team manage to achieve? The project attracted the attention of dozens of thousands of fans from more than 100 countries, it was mentioned in the media, including Wall Street Journal and New York Times and also it received partnership with such sharks as Sports Illustrated and Amazon Twitch. And the team itself moved into third place in League.
